In this study, the mobile MutS clamps were trapped on DNA in a functional state using single-cysteine variants of MutS and thiol-modified homoduplex or heteroduplex DNA. This approach allows stabilization of various transient MutS-DNA complexes and will enable their structural and functional analysis.enIn Copyrightddc:570Covalently trapping MutS on DNA to study DNA mismatch recognition and signaling
